Boutique medicine—what is it, why does it matter, and what should you do if you're interested in pursuing it further? Here's the scoop.
Boutique medicine is another name for concierge medicine. It's also known as personalized medicine because you work directly with your doctor regarding your health and payment for his or her services. Instead of using insurance, you pay your doctor directly in the form of a monthly or annual retainer fee

The beauty of boutique medicine is the personalization that's involved.
Boutique medicine isn't as expensive as you might think. According to Concierge Medicine Today, "over 62% of the fees touted by direct-pay or concierge medicine doctors cost patients less than $135 per month." Most people who enroll in a concierge program also continue to carry a form of catastrophic insurance to take care of services not covered by the retainer fee, such as hospitalization.
